QED's superior Toslink Optical digital audio interconnect cable made with real glass

Reference Optical Quartz is the first of its kind, consisting of 210 separate boro-silicate glass fibers. The cable allows you to experience stunning sound when connecting DACs, TV's, CD players and Blu-Ray players to amplifiers or receivers because it has a much higher bandwidth and only 1/10th of the attenuation of traditional acrylic fibers. Reference Optical Quartz vastly exceeds the demands for high definition multi-channel digital audio with a bandwidth of over 150MHz which is totally unaffected by bending the cable.

FEATURES AND BENEFITS

GLASSCORE TECHNOLOGY

QED's new Glasscore™ technology employs multiple fibre bundles of ultra-fine boro-silicate glass optical fibres (GOF) of no more than 50um each to make up the 1 mm diameter necessary to conform to the Toslink standard connectors. Because the fibres are so small the different paths taken by the light rays are similar in length virtually eliminating the timing error and introducing less distortion and jitter. This has the effect of increasing bandwidth and the accuracy of the data transmission.

STEPPED REFRACTIVE INDEX

The quartz fibres are coated with a cladding of low Refractive Index to guide the light signal.

Over 150MHz BANDWIDTH

This vastly exceeds the demands for high definition multi-channel HD digital audio. In contrast to conventional acrylic glass optical cables quartz glass cables can deliver signals up to and including 24bit/192kHz with very low jitter .

Reference Optical Quartz can provide a much higher bandwidth than a single acrylic glass fibre with 1/10th of the attenuation.

ULTRA LOW JITTER / ULTRA LOW LOSS

QED have calculated that jitter (distortions caused by timing differences between the different light paths) in conventional optical cables could typically reach up to 145ps. In Reference Optical Quartz, timing errors are virtually eliminated, introducing less distortion, jitter and ultra low loss < 0.03 dB/m.

Glasscore™ Technology

Instead of using traditional low performance polymethyl methacrylate (PMMA) plastic optical fibres (POF) which come as a single 1 mm OD fibre the cable incorporates 210+ boro-silcate glass optical fibres (GOF) which give improved jitter performance and higher bandwidth capability. 24 & 32 bit high resolution audio compatible.

 
Ultra Low Jitter

Ultra Low Jitter

Jitter is the undesired deviation from true periodicity of an assumed periodic signal in electronics and telecommunications, often in relation to a reference clock source. A cable displaying ultra low jitter has been measured at
typically 30ps.
